Skocz do zawartości
Peri Noid

Jak dokładnie sprawdzić, co się dzieje w systemie podczas uruchamiania?

    Rekomendowane odpowiedzi

    Czy znacie jakiś sposób, jak wyciągnąć z systemu dokładne informacje, co się dzieje w nim podczas startu? Pacjentem jest N9005 ze stockowym KK 4.4.2, zrootowany, wgrane Xposed i Greenify. Mam dość dużo aplikacji zainstalowanych, ale kontroluję je chyba dość skutecznie za pomocą aplikacji dla Xposed.

     

    Mój Note3 bardzo długo się uruchamia i chciałbym to zdiagnozować. Ostatnio notorycznie wyświetla przy tym komunikat "Proces system nie odpowiada" z propozycją zamknięcia (oczywiście nie ma to sensu bo to oznacza reboot). Wystarczy poczekać. Jak już się uruchomi, to działa całkiem żwawo, ale po jakimś czasie (kilka dni) zaczyna mulić. Nie jest to kwestia zajętości pamięci bo po sprawdzeniu wciąż zostaje kilkaset kilo, ale zwykle jej wyczyszczenie pomaga. Natomiast symptomatyczne jest to, że przy kolejnych czyszczeniach (z poziomu ustawień telefonu, nie za pomocą dodatkowych narzędzi), wolnej pamięci zostaje coraz mniej. Dodatkowo bardzo zastanawiające jest, że instalacja/aktualizacja aplikacji trwa dłuuuugo... Jak porównuję z S5 mojej żony, to jest to kilka razy więcej. Czyżby magazyn danych aż tak zwolnił przy zapisie? Używam co jakiś czas fstrim, ale niewiele pomaga. Pamięć na dane jest w połowie pusta i nigdy nie była zapełniona więcej niż w 2/3, karta pamięci też ma wciąż 20GB miejsca (ma 64GB).

     

    To nie jest temat mojego postu, ale od razu zaznaczę, że nie wchodzi w grę robienie resetu do stanu fabrycznego i konfiguracja od nowa - jak pisałem, mam sporo aplikacji, już pokonfigurowanych i nie mam czasu ani ochoty na przechodzenie tego od nowa. Nie będę również robił aktualizacji do 5.x - przyczyny jak powyżej plus Xposed.

    Udostępnij tę odpowiedź


    Odnośnik do odpowiedzi
    Udostępnij na innych stronach
    piskorfa

    Jedyny sposób na sprawdzenie, co się dzieje podczas uruchamiania systemu, to logcat, androidowy log, w którym widać wszystkie informacje, jakie wykonuje system

    O logcat możesz poczytać np. tu:

    Jest też aplikacja od Chainfire nazwana LiveBoot, która jest w stanie podczas uruchamiania systemu wyświetlać zdarzenia systemowe na ekranie i zapisać je do pliku tekstowego

    http://forum.xda-developers.com/android/apps-games/liveboot-t2976189

    https://play.google.com/store/apps/details?id=eu.chainfire.liveboot

     

    Udostępnij tę odpowiedź


    Odnośnik do odpowiedzi
    Udostępnij na innych stronach
    frrancuz

    1. Wywal xposed. Jestem na 80% przekonany że to jego sprawka. Sam zrezygnowałem z niego dawno temu, i to była bdb decyzja.
    2. Xposed od dłuższego czasu działa bez problemu i komplikacji na 5.0
    Nic nie trzeba kombinować, wgrywasz 1 plik. xposed FAQ
    Ostatni post, o ile pamiętam.


    Udostępnij tę odpowiedź


    Odnośnik do odpowiedzi
    Udostępnij na innych stronach
    piskorfa
    10 minut temu, frrancuz napisał:

    1. Wywal xposed. Jestem na 80% przekonany że to jego sprawka. Sam zrezygnowałem z niego dawno temu, i to była bdb decyzja.

    Samo xposed raczej nie jest problemem, ewentualnie używane moduły. Framework z powodzeniem uzywam od Kitkata i zawsze czekam na jego w miarę stabilną wersję, żeby przesiąść się na wyższy system.

    W tej chwili czekam na xposed dla 7.1 :)

    Udostępnij tę odpowiedź


    Odnośnik do odpowiedzi
    Udostępnij na innych stronach

    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to

    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.

    Zarejestruj nowe konto

    Załóż nowe konto. To bardzo proste!

    Zarejestruj się

    Zaloguj się

    Posiadasz już konto? Zaloguj się poniżej.

    Zaloguj się

    • Ostatnio przeglądający   0 użytkowników

      Brak zarejestrowanych użytkowników przeglądających tę stronę.

    x